GORGONZOLA STUFFED CHICKEN BREASTS WRAPPED IN BACON



Gorgonzola Stuffed Chicken Breasts Wrapped in Bacon image

Chicken teams up with two of my favorite things: Gorgonzola cheese and bacon!

Time 55m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
¼ cup crumbled Gorgonzola cheese
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
2 tablespoons minced shallot
1 clove garlic, minced
4 thick slices of applewood smoked bacon
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Spray an 8x8-inch ba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Using a sharp knife, cut a slit into the thick side of each chicken breast about 2 inches long and 1 1/2 inches deep.
  • Mash together the Gorgonzola cheese, parsley, shallot, and garlic in a small bowl; season with salt and black pepper. Divide the filling in half, and stuff each chicken breast with cheese filling. Wrap 2 slices of bacon around each breast, and secure with wooden toothpicks. Place the chicken breasts into the prepared baking dish.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until the bacon is browned and the chicken is no longer pink inside, about 35 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center of a breast should read about 165 degrees F (75 degrees C).

GORGONZOLA CHICKEN SALAD (FRED MEYER DELI COPYCAT)



Gorgonzola Chicken Salad (Fred Meyer Deli Copycat) image

This is an exact copycat recipe of the totally easy and delicious Chicken Gorgonzola Salad available in the Fred Meyer Deli case (recipe deciphered by Bitchin' Vittles.) It's a light, flavorful summer salad that is sure to be a huge hit at your next potluck, BBQ or family get together!

Time 35m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 lb penne pasta
2 boneless skinless chicken breasts
1/2 teaspoon lemon pepper seasoning (to taste)
2 cups red grapes (seedless, sliced in half)
4 green onions (thinly sliced)
1/3 cup pecans (coarsely chopped)
1/2 cup gorgonzola (crumbled)
1 cup mayonnaise (for best results, use a quality brand like Best Foods)
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
2 tablespoons seasoned rice vinegar (you may use apple cider vinegar, but rice vinegar is better here)
3 tablespoons white sugar (to taste)
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t (regular table salt will be TOO SALTY)
1/4 teaspoon black pepper (to taste)

Steps:

  • Cook the pasta according to the package directions, NOT al dente. You don't want it to be too gummy or too mushy. Drain in a colander and run COLD water over until it's completely cold. Transfer to a large bowl.
  • Sprinkle the chicken breasts with lemon pepper. "Grill" the chicken breasts by whatever method you prefer. You may use a panini type grill, a barbecue grill, or simply bake in the oven. Your cooking times will vary based on your method, but just make sure the breasts are fully cooked by reaching an internal temperature of 165 degrees, or when the juices run clear. Allow the chicken pieces to cool until you can handle them. Slice the chicken thinly, then cut slices in half so they are bite-sized. Spread out to cool completely while you prepare the remaining ingredients.
  • Pour the dressing ingredients (mayo, oil, vinegar, sugar, salt, pepper) into the bowl and whisk until incorporated.
  • After the chicken and pasta are completely cooled, add all the remaining ingredients to the bowl and stir gently. Refrigerate until ready to serve.
  • TIPS: If the salad is too stiff after prolonged refrigeration, you can make it creamy again by stirring in a tiny bit of olive oil, milk or warm water. Gorgonzola cheese is similar to bleu cheese, but slightly milder. It is an acquired taste for some people, so feel free to use more or less to taste. I use MORE! For best results, don't substitute or omit ingredients. I usually try doing things to lower fat or calories, but in this case, the results will NOT be the same.

PENNE GORGONZOLA WITH CHICKEN



Penne Gorgonzola with Chicken image

This rich, creamy pasta dish is a snap to throw together for a weeknight meal but special enough for company. You can substitute another cheese for the Gorgonzola if you like. -George Schroeder, Port Murray, New Jersey

Time 30m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 package (16 ounces) penne pasta
1 pound bo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 large garlic clove, minced
1/4 cup white wine
1 cup heavy whipping cream
1/4 cup chicken broth
2 cups crumbled Gorgonzola cheese
6 to 8 fresh sage leaves, thinly sliced
Salt and pepper to taste
Grated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ese and minced f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Cook pasta according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a large skillet over medium heat, brown chicken in oil on all sides.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Add wine, stirring to loosen browned bits from pan., Add cream and broth; cook until sauce is slightly thickened and chicken is no longer pink. Stir in the Gorgonzola cheese, sage, salt and pepper; cook just until cheese is melted., Drain pasta; toss with sauce. Sprinkle with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ese and parsley.

POTATO SALAD WITH BACON AND GORGONZOLA

Time 30m

Yield 10-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

5 lbs yukon gold potatoes, peeled, cut into 3/4-inch cubes
2 1/2 cups mayonnaise, divided
3/4 lb bacon, slices
2 cups gorgonzola, crumbled
1 cup green onion, chopped
1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ped

Steps:

  • Cook potatoes in large pot of boiling salted water until just tender, about 5 minutes. Drain potatoes; return to same pot. Place over very low heat just until excess moisture evaporates, about 1 minute. Transfer hot potatoes to large bowl; Cool 10 minutes(minimum). Mix in 2 cups mayonnaise, low fat variety optional.
  • Cook bacon in large heavy skillet over medium-high heat until brown and crisp. Transfer bacon to paper towels to drain. Cool bacon; crumble coarsely.
  • Mix remaining 1/2 cup mayonnaise, cheese, green onions, parsley and half of bacon into potatoes. Season salad to taste with salt and peper (I prefer a mixture of white and cayenne pepper and seasoning salt) Sprinkle with remaining bacon. (Can be made 2 hours ahead. Let stand at cool room temperature.).

CHICKEN-GORGONZOLA PASTA SALAD

Time 30m

Yield 1 1/2 cups each,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

7 cups uncooked radiatore, pasta (nuggets, about 19 oz.)
4 1/2 cups cubed cooked chicken breasts (about 20 oz.)
1 (2 1/8 ounce) package precooked bacon, cut up into small pieces (about 15 slices)
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can fire roasted diced tomatoes, drained
2 cups fresh baby spinach leaves, lightly packed
1 (16 ounce) jar refrigerated ranch dressing
1 cup gorgonzola, crumbled (4 oz)
bibb lettuce, if desired (optional)

Steps:

  • Cook and drain pasta as directed on package.
  • In a large bowl, mix cooked pasta, chicken, bacon, tomatoes and spinach.
  • Pour dressing over pasta mixture, toss until coated.
  • Fold in cheese.
  • Cover and refrigerate until serving.
  • To serve, line bowl with lettuce and spoon in salad.

CREAMY CHICKEN AND BACON GORGONZOLA

Time 40m

Yield 2 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 chicken breasts
4 slices bacon
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 shallot, diced
1/2 teaspoon thyme
1/2 teaspoon marjoram
black pepper
1/4 cup white wine
1/4 cup cream
1/4 cup gorgonzola

Steps:

  • 1. Fry bacon in a heavy skillet; once bacon is done remove from skillet, crumble and set aside.
  • 2. Add to chicken, shallot, garlic, marjoram and thyme and let chicken brown. Add wine and cover. Let simmer for 10 minutes or so untill chicken is cooked through. Uncover and stir in cream, gorgonzola and bacon. Allow gorganzola to melt. Serve over pasta or rice.
